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    Feb 2004
    Messaggi
    263

    Chiusura temporizzata di una finestra

    Ciao a tutti.
    Probabilmente quello che sto per chiedere è banale, ma non sono un esperto javascript e non riesco a venirne fuori.
    Ho un help che gestisto con js. Quando ci clicco sopra mi apre una finestra, che mi visualizza il messaggio di help, attraverso il seguente codice:

    function explain(name, output, msg, required) {
    newwin = window.open('','Stessa','top=150,left=150,width=32 5,height=300');
    newwin.focus();
    if (!newwin.opener) newwin.opener = self;
    with (newwin.document)
    {
    open();
    write('<html>');
    write('

    <center><font face="Verdana, Arial, sans-serif" size="2"> ' + name + ' ' + '
    ' + '
    ');
    write('<body bgcolor=9BD2D2 onLoad="document.form_company.box.focus()"><form name=form_company>' + msg + '
    ');
    write('

    <center> ' + required + ' ' + '
    ');
    write('

    <center><input type=button value="Click to close when finished" onClick=window.close()>');
    write('</center></form></body></html>');
    close();
    }
    }

    Funziona perfettamente.
    Vorrei però che nella finestra che mi apre nella barra venisse visualizzata la parola "HELP" e che comunque dopo un tot secondi, se l'utente non la chiude, la finestra si chiuda da sola.

    Come si può fare ?

    Grazie per l'aiuto.
    Marco

  2. #2
    Moderatore di JavaScript L'avatar di br1
    Registrato dal
    Jul 1999
    Messaggi
    19,998
    codice:
    ...
    ...
    open();
    write('<html>');
    write('<title>HELP</title><body onload="setTimeout(\\'window.close()\\',5000)">');
    write('
    
    <center><font face="Verdana, Arial, sans-serif" size="2"> ' + name + ' ' + ' 
    ' + ' 
    ');
    ...
    ...
    ciao
    Il guaio per i poveri computers e' che sono gli uomini a comandarli.

    Attenzione ai titoli delle discussioni: (ri)leggete il regolamento
    Consultate la discussione in rilievo: script / discussioni utili
    Usate la funzione di Ricerca del Forum

  3. #3
    Utente di HTML.it
    Registrato dal
    Feb 2004
    Messaggi
    263
    Perfetto.

    Grazie 1000

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.